Cut and paste everything between the lines and paste it into notepad. Save
the file as quick.reg and save it to the desktop. make sure you change the
save as type.... drop down box to all files. Once saved double click on the
file to merge it into the registry. Reboot.


Begin cut below this line
================================================== =================================
Windows Registry Editor Version 5.00

[H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\Microsoft\Windows\Curre ntVersion\Policies\Explorer]
"NoSaveSettings"=dword:00000000



================================================== ==================================
End cut above this line

The above will fix the quick launch issue and may also fix the system
restore if it does not then use this one.
